1.) Understanding the Limitations of Current AI Technologies



1. Predictability: Many AI systems used today are based on algorithms that can be predictable. This predictability limits their ability to handle unexpected situations or scenarios beyond what they were programmed for, which is a significant drawback in complex game environments where unpredictable player behavior and events are the norm.
2. Scalability: Large-scale AI systems often require substantial computational power and resources, making them difficult to scale across different platforms and hardware configurations without performance degradation. This scalability issue can hinder development timelines and budgets.
3. Cost: Developing sophisticated AI systems is not cheap. The cost associated with research, infrastructure setup, maintenance, and updates can be a significant barrier for indie developers or smaller studios that might struggle to allocate resources effectively.
4. Realism vs. Fun: While striving for realistic AI behavior is important, it must be balanced against gameplay mechanics that provide fun and engaging experiences. Overly realistic but unintuitive AI can alienate players, reducing their enjoyment of the game.




2.) The Role of Human Intervention



1. Design Oversight: To overcome some limitations, developers often resort to human oversight where designers intervene manually in complex situations or use machine learning techniques that require ongoing manual tuning and updating. This additional workload offsets some of the benefits claimed by AI advocates but is necessary for maintaining control over gameplay elements influenced by AI.
2. Balancing Automation with Creativity: A healthy balance between automated systems and human creativity is crucial. While automation can handle routine tasks, creative decisions often require human intuition and judgment. Over-reliance on AI in this area can stifle innovation and artistic expression within the team.




3.) The Importance of Continuous Learning and Adaptation



1. Machine Learning: Implementing machine learning models that can learn from gameplay data to improve their performance is an ongoing challenge. These systems require vast amounts of data, which may not always be available or representative of all possible player interactions. Furthermore, the interpretability of AI decisions becomes a critical issue as more complex models are used.
2. Adaptive Systems: Adaptive systems that can adjust in real-time to different gameplay scenarios and environments have shown promise but require sophisticated algorithms capable of handling rapid changes in context. These systems need substantial computational resources and ongoing optimization, which may not be feasible for all game projects.




4.) Ethical Considerations



1. Player Experience: AI decisions should contribute positively to the player experience by creating challenges that are fair yet engaging. Overly simplistic or overly complex AI can lead to frustration among players, affecting their overall enjoyment of the game.
2. Fairness and Transparency: Ensuring fairness in gameplay mechanics influenced by AI is essential. This includes transparency about how decisions are made when automated systems are used. Players should understand why certain events occur based on AI behavior without being confused or frustrated by unpredictable outcomes.
